
DEVSECOPS Talks #25 -All The Things You Wanted To Know About Pulumi. Explained
The DevSecOps Talks Podcast
00:00
Creating a Multi-Language Ecosystem That Developers Can Take Advantage Of
Multi-language means that you can write your module or your package in Go and expose that same package to other languages. So let's think of the use case here. You have a centralized operations team or a centralized infrastructure team who has to create modules and packages for people around the IT department. That infrastructure team writes in Go. The database guys or the UI people, they don't know Go. So you can give it to them, package it up as the binary, and then Pulumi will understand that it translates internally in the binary that somebody is calling our EKS package in TypeScript. It actually needs to translate into the Go API on the hood.
Transcript
Play full episode